Apple Pages Keyboard Shortcuts for macOS

Apple Pages Keyboard Shortcuts for MacOS. View hotkeys online or download free PDF Cheat Sheet to write, edit, and format documents faster on Mac.

Show table of contentsPrint shortcutsSign in to download the PDF It takes a few seconds.
Sign in →
Sign in to save this shortcuts set to favorites.
Sign in →
Key label style

General

Start dictation
Fn+D
Create a new document (open the template chooser)
Cmd+N
Open the template chooser and show the Language pop-up menu
Cmd+Opt+N
Close the template chooser
Esc
Open an existing document (open the document manager)
Cmd+O
Save a document
Cmd+S
Save As
Cmd+Opt+Shift+S
Duplicate a document
Cmd+Shift+S
Print a document
Cmd+P
Open the Pages User Guide
Cmd+Shift+/
Close a window
Cmd+W
Close all windows
Cmd+Opt+W
Minimize a window
Cmd+M
Minimize all windows
Cmd+Opt+M
Enter full-screen view
Cmd+Ctrl+F
Increase text size
Cmd+=
Decrease text size
Cmd+-
Zoom out/in
Cmd+Shift+,.
Zoom to selection
Cmd+Shift+0
Return to actual size
Cmd+0
Show or hide the ruler
Cmd+R
Open the Page Setup window
Cmd+Shift+P
Show or hide layout boundaries
Cmd+Shift+L
Show formatting characters (invisibles)
Cmd+Shift+I
Choose a file to insert
Cmd+Shift+V
Show the Colors window
Cmd+Shift+C
Hide or show the toolbar
Cmd+Opt+T
Rearrange an item in the toolbar
Cmd+Drag
Remove an item from the toolbar
Cmd+Drag away
Hide or show sidebars on the right side of the Pages window
Cmd+Opt+I
Open the next tab in the sidebar
Ctrl+`
Open the previous tab in the sidebar
Ctrl+Shift+`
Hide Pages
Cmd+H
Hide windows of other applications
Cmd+Opt+H
Undo the last action
Cmd+Z
Redo the last action
Cmd+Shift+Z
Open Pages settings
Cmd+,
Quit Pages
Cmd+Q
Quit Pages and keep windows open
Cmd+Opt+Q

Move around within a document

Move one character to the left
Left
Move one character to the right
Right
Move one character backward (works for left-to-right and right-to-left text)
Ctrl+B
Move one character forward (works for left-to-right and right-to-left text)
Ctrl+F
Move to the line above
Up
Move to the line below
Down
Move to the beginning of the current or previous word
Ctrl+Opt+B
Move to the left edge of the current word (works for left-to-right and right-to-left text)
Opt+Left
Move to the end of the current or next word
Ctrl+Opt+F
Move to the right edge of the current word (works for left-to-right and right-to-left text)
Opt+Right
Move the insertion point to the beginning of the current text area (document, text box, shape, or table cell)
Cmd+Up
Move the insertion point to the bottom of the current text area (document, text box, shape, or table cell)
Cmd+Down
Move to the beginning of the paragraph
Ctrl+A
or
Opt+Up
Move to the end of the paragraph
Ctrl+E
or
Opt+Down
Move to the left edge of the current line
Cmd+Left
Move to the right edge of the current line
Cmd+Right
Scroll up one page without moving the insertion point
Fn+Up
or
Pg Up
Scroll down one page without moving the insertion point
Fn+Down
or
Pg Dn
Scroll up one page and move the insertion point
Opt+Pg Up
Scroll down one page and move the insertion point
Ctrl+V
or
Opt+Pg Dn
Move to the beginning of the document without moving the insertion point
Home
or
Fn+Left
Move to the end of the document without moving the insertion point
End
or
Fn+Right
Center the insertion point in the center of the application window
Ctrl+L
Go to a specific page
Cmd+Ctrl+G

Select text

Select one or more characters
Click+Drag
Select a word
Double-click
Select a paragraph
Triple-click
Select all objects and text
Cmd+A
Deselect all objects and text
Cmd+Shift+A
Extend the text selection
Click,Shift+Click
Extend the selection one character to the right
Shift+Right
Extend the selection one character to the left
Shift+Left
Extend the selection to the end of the current word, then to the end of subsequent words
Opt+Shift+Right
Extend the selection to the beginning of the current word
Opt+Shift+Left
Extend the selection to the end of the current line
Cmd+Shift+Right
Extend the selection to the beginning of the current line
Cmd+Shift+Left
Extend the selection to the line above
Shift+Up
Extend the selection to the line below
Shift+Down
Extend the selection to the beginning of the current paragraph
Opt+Shift+Up
Extend the selection to the end of the current paragraph
Opt+Shift+Down
Extend the selection to the beginning of the text
Cmd+Shift+Up
or
Shift+Home
Extend the selection to the end of the text
Cmd+Shift+Down
or
Shift+End
Select a bullet and its text
Click
Move a bullet and its text, with its sub-bullets and text
Click+Drag

Format text

Show the Fonts window
Cmd+T
Show the Colors window
Cmd+Shift+C
Apply boldface to selected text
Cmd+B
Apply italic to selected text
Cmd+I
Apply underline to selected text
Cmd+U
Delete the previous character or selection
Del
or
Ctrl+H
Delete the next character or selection
Ctrl+D
or
Fwd Del
Delete the word before the insertion point
Opt+Del
Delete the word after the insertion point
Opt+Fwd Del
Delete the text between the insertion point and the next paragraph break
Ctrl+K
Make the font size bigger
Cmd+=
Make the font size smaller
Cmd+-
Decrease (tighten) the space between selected characters
Cmd+Opt+[
Increase (loosen) the space between selected characters
Cmd+Opt+]
Make the text superscript
Cmd+Ctrl+Shift+=
Make the text subscript
Cmd+Ctrl+-
Align the text flush left
Cmd+Shift+[
Center the text
Cmd+Shift+\
Align the text flush right
Cmd+Shift+]
Align the text flush left and flush right (justify)
Cmd+Opt+Shift+\
Decrease the indent level of a block of text or a list item
Cmd+[
Increase the indent level of a block of text or a list item
Cmd+]
Decrease the indent level of a list item
Shift+Tab
Increase the indent level of a list item
Tab
Add a bookmark
Cmd+Opt+B
Cut the selection
Cmd+X
Copy the selection
Cmd+C
Copy the paragraph style
Cmd+Opt+C
Paste the selection
Cmd+V
Paste the paragraph style
Cmd+Opt+V
Paste and match the style of the destination text
Cmd+Opt+Shift+V
Copy the graphic style of text
Cmd+Opt+C
Paste the graphic style of text
Cmd+Opt+V
Add a range to (or remove it from) the selection
Shift+Drag
Insert a nonbreaking space
Opt+Space
Insert a line break (soft return)
Shift+Return
Insert a paragraph break
Return
Insert a new line after the insertion point
Ctrl+O
Insert a page break
Cmd+Return
Enter special characters
Cmd+Ctrl+Space
Transpose the characters on either side of the insertion point
Ctrl+T
Add an EndNote bibliography
Cmd+Opt+Shift+E

Find and delete text, use comments, and check spelling

Delete the previous character or selection
Del
Delete the next character or selection
Fn+Del
or
Fwd Del
Find
Cmd+F
Find next (while in the Find window)
Cmd+G
Find previous (while in the Find window)
Cmd+Shift+G
Place the selected text in the Find & Replace text field
Cmd+E
Replace text
Return
Scroll the window to show the selected text or object
Cmd+J
Hide the Find window
Esc
Look up the word at the insertion point
Cmd+Ctrl+D
Display a list of words to complete the selected word
Opt+Esc
Check spelling and grammar
Cmd+;
Show the “Spelling and Grammar” window
Cmd+Shift+;
Highlight text
Cmd+Shift+H
Open a new comment for the selected text, object, or table cell
Cmd+Shift+K
Save a comment
Cmd+Return
Show the next comment
Cmd+Opt+K
Show the previous comment
Cmd+Opt+Shift+K
Accept a change (when change tracking is on)
Cmd+Opt+A
Reject a change (when change tracking is on)
Cmd+Opt+R
Show or hide word count
Cmd+Shift+W
Enter or exit Edit Page Template view
Cmd+Shift+E

Move, group, layer, and resize objects

Select all objects
Cmd+A
Deselect all objects
Cmd+Shift+A
Select objects by dragging. In page layout documents, drag from a blank part of the page around objects. Option-drag to select objects outward from the starting point
Drag
or
Opt+Drag
Scroll zoom (for Magic Mouse or a trackpad)
Cmd+Opt+Scroll
Add or remove objects from the selection
Cmd+Drag
Select the previous object on the page
Shift+Tab
Select or deselect additional objects
Cmd+Click
or
Shift+Click
Move selected objects
Drag
Move the selected object one point
UpDownLeftRight
Move the selected object ten points
Shift+UpDownLeftRight
Move the selected object one screen pixel
UpDownLeftRight
Move the selected object ten screen pixels
Shift+UpDownLeftRight
Copy the graphic style
Cmd+Opt+C
Paste the graphic style
Cmd+Opt+V
Apply the shape style but not its text style (by clicking the shape style in the sidebar on the right side of the Pages window)
Opt+Click
Send the selected object to the back
Cmd+Shift+B
Send the selected object one layer back
Cmd+Opt+Shift+B
Bring the selected object to the front
Cmd+Shift+F
Bring the selected object one layer forward
Cmd+Opt+Shift+F
Group selected objects
Cmd+Opt+G
Ungroup selected objects
Cmd+Opt+Shift+G
Select an object in a group
Double-click
Select the next object in a group
Tab
Select the previous object in a group
Shift+Tab
End editing an object, then select the group. Press with an object in a group selected
Cmd+Return
Lock selected objects
Cmd+L
Unlock selected objects
Cmd+Opt+L
Duplicate the object
Opt+UpDownLeftRight
or
Opt+Drag
Constrain the movement of the object horizontally, vertically, or diagonally (45°)
Shift+Drag
Resize the object
Drag a handle
Disable alignment guides while moving or resizing an object
Cmd+Drag
Resize the object from the center
Opt+Drag a handle
Constrain the aspect ratio when resizing the object
Shift+Drag a handle
Constrain the aspect ratio when resizing the object from the center
Opt+Shift+Drag a handle
Rotate the object
Cmd+Drag a handle
Rotate the object 45°. Press while rotating
Shift+Drag a handle
Rotate the object around the opposite handle (instead of the center)
Cmd+Opt+Drag a handle
Rotate the object 45° around the opposite handle (instead of the center)
Cmd+Opt+Shift+Drag a handle
Mask or unmask the image
Cmd+Shift+M
Hide image mask controls
Return
or
Double-click
Show image mask controls
Double-click
Open the shortcut menu for the selected item
Ctrl+Click
Exit text editing and select the object
Cmd+Return
Choose an object to insert
Cmd+Shift+V
Define the selected text as a text placeholder
Cmd+Ctrl+Opt+T
Define the image or movie as a media placeholder
Cmd+Ctrl+Opt+I

Modify editable shapes

Make a custom shape editable (by double-clicking the edge of the shape)
Double-click
Draw a custom shape with the Pen tool
Cmd+Opt+Shift+P
Move a point of an editable shape
Drag
Delete a point of an editable shape
Click,Del
Add a sharp point to an editable shape. Drag the midpoint of a line
Cmd+Drag
Add a smooth point to an editable shape. Drag the midpoint of a line
Drag
Add a Bézier point to an editable shape. Drag the midpoint of a line
Opt+Drag
Change a curve point of an editable shape into a corner point
Double-click
Reshape the curve of a smooth point (by dragging the line adjacent to the smooth point)
Drag
Reshape the curve of a Bézier point
Click,Drag the control

Work with tables

Add a row above the selected cells
Opt+Up
Add a row below the selected cells
Opt+Down
Add a column to the right of the selected cells
Opt+Right
Add a column to the left of the selected cells
Opt+Left
Insert a row at the bottom of the table
Opt+Return
Select an entire row or column in the selected table (by clicking the letter for the column or the number for the row)
Click
Select all rows that intersect the current selection
Cmd+Opt+Return
Select all columns that intersect the current selection
Cmd+Ctrl+Return
Select additional rows
Shift+UpDown
Select additional columns
Shift+LeftRight
Select additional cells
Shift+Click
Select only body cells in a row or column (by double-clicking the letter for the column or the number for the row)
Double-click
Move the cell selection to the beginning of the next row (with a cell in the rightmost column selected)
Tab
Stop the reordering of rows or columns. Press while dragging
Esc
Select a table from a cell selection
Cmd+Return
Select all content in a table (with a cell selected)
Cmd+A
Delete the selected table, or the contents of selected cells
Del
Replace the contents of the selected cell with the contents of the destination cell (by dragging selected cell to another)
Drag
Copy the contents of the selected cell into the destination cell (by dragging selected cell to another)
Opt+Drag
Copy cell style
Cmd+Opt+C
Paste cell style
Cmd+Opt+V
Paste and preserve the style of the destination cell
Cmd+Opt+Shift+V
Extend the selection from the selected cell to the destination cell
Shift+Click
Select a cell in a selected or an unselected table
Click
or
Double-click
Add a cell to (or remove it from) the selection
Cmd+Click
Begin text editing (in a selected cell)
Return
Auto-align cell content
Cmd+Opt+U
Stop editing the cell and select the cell
Cmd+Return
Stop editing the cell and select the table
Cmd+Return+Return
Move the selected table one point
UpDownLeftRight
Move the selected table ten points
Shift+UpDownLeftRight
Constrain the movement of the table horizontally, vertically, or diagonally (45°)
Shift+Drag
Resize all columns in a table proportionately (with the table selected)
Shift+Drag a handle
Select the next cell to the left, right, up, or down (from a selected cell)
UpDownLeftRight
Extend the cell selection by one cell (from a selected cell)
Shift+UpDownLeftRight
Select the next cell
Tab
Select the previous cell
Shift+Tab
Insert a tab when editing text or a formula
Opt+Tab
Insert a line break (soft return) when editing text in a cell
Shift+Return
Insert a paragraph break (hard return) when editing text in a cell
Return
Open the Formula Editor for the selected nonformula cell
=
Open the Formula Editor for the cell containing a formula or formatted number
Double-click
In the Formula Editor, commit changes
Return
or
Tab
In the Formula Editor, discard changes
Esc
Select the first populated cell in the current row
Cmd+Opt+Left
Select the last populated cell in the current row
Cmd+Opt+Right
Select the first populated cell in the current column
Cmd+Opt+Up
Select the last populated cell in the current column
Cmd+Opt+Down
Delete selected rows
Cmd+Opt+Del
Delete selected columns
Cmd+Ctrl+Del
Select the table name
Shift+Tab
Select the first cell in a selected table
Return
Expand the current selection to include the first populated cell in the current row
Cmd+Opt+Shift+Left
Expand the current selection to include the last populated cell in the current row
Cmd+Opt+Shift+Right
Expand the current selection to include the first populated cell in the current column
Cmd+Opt+Shift+Up
Expand the current selection to include the last populated cell in the current column
Cmd+Opt+Shift+Down
Merge selected cells
Cmd+Ctrl+M
Unmerge selected cells
Cmd+Ctrl+Shift+M
Add or remove the top border
Cmd+Ctrl+Opt+Up
Add or remove the bottom border
Cmd+Ctrl+Opt+Down
Add or remove the right border
Cmd+Ctrl+Opt+Right
Add or remove the left border
Cmd+Ctrl+Opt+Left
Turn on autofill mode
Cmd+\
Autofill from the column before
Cmd+Ctrl+\
Autofill from the row above
Cmd+Opt+\

Edit chart data

Insert an equation
Cmd+Opt+E
Show or hide the Chart Data editor
Cmd+Shift+D
Complete a cell entry and move the selection down
Return
Complete a cell entry and move the selection up
Shift+Return
Complete a cell entry and move the selection to the right
Tab
Complete a cell entry and move the selection to the left
Shift+Tab
Move one character to the left or right
LeftRight
Move to the beginning of text or to the end of text
UpDown
Move the chart legend one point (with the legend selected)
UpDownLeftRight
Move the chart legend ten points (with the legend selected)
Shift+UpDownLeftRight

Create cell references in formulas

Navigate to and select a single cell
Opt+UpDownLeftRight
Extend or shrink a selected cell reference
Opt+Shift+UpDownLeftRight
Navigate to and select the first or last cell in a row or column
Cmd+Opt+UpDownLeftRight
Change a selected cell reference back to text (with a reference selected)
Opt+Return
Specify absolute and relative attributes of selected cell references. Press to move forward or backward through options
Cmd+K
or
Cmd+Shift+K
Specify absolute and relative attributes of the first and last cells of selected cell references. Press to move forward or backward through options
Cmd+Opt+K
or
Cmd+Opt+Shift+K

Need more than shortcuts?
Visit the Apple Pages app page for an overview and helpful links.

Want to suggest a new app, report a bug, or get help? Email us at info@hkeys.appCopy email.

For anything else or just a quick hello, write to us at info@hkeys.appCopy email.